Shoot during the “golden hours,” especially if you are shooting human subjects. The time around dawn and dusk are named “golden hours” because the hue of the light makes objects look like they are glowing. This light also complements human skin, making human subjects appear to look better than they would in photos taken at other times of day.
This next piece of advice is helpful! You should take the time to educate yourself on shutter speed. On your camera, you should find several settings including the S, M, A, and P settings. Using the “P” setting will put your camera into program mode. This automatic setting sets your aperture and shutter speed automatically. If you do not know what you will be taking a picture of, have the “P” setting on.
One of the key ways to take great photographs is to take lots and lots of them, so buy a large memory card that can hold them all. If you have a good-sized memory card, you won’t need to worry in regards to the amount of room you have. You will be able to store plenty of pictures. Yet another advantage to lots of memory is that it allows you to shoot in a format called RAW, giving you greater flexibility when you edit it later.
